Working on a rebuilt of some thing I already kitbashed once before. Bachmann 0-6-0 tank with a switching platform flat car with Athearn caboose electrical pick up trucks. I need to remount the motor and run all new wire with thinner gauge wire . Also bypassed the LED resister by accident and smoked the head light so will need to rebuild the head light as well. When it runs right will add some more details and repair the ones I broke off when I took it apart then weather it. Will post photos when done.
